Initially, the reaction of 1-methylquinoxalin-2(1
H)-one (
1a), styrene (
2a), and ethyl diazoacetate (
3a) was carried out to optimize the reaction conditions in the presence of water with the irradiation of 3 W blue LED lamps (445–465 nm). Gratifyingly, the desired ester-containing quinoxalin-2(1
H)-one
4aa was obtained in 34% yield when the reaction was conducted using 1,2,3,5-tetrakis(carbazol-9-yl)-4,6-dicyanobenzene (4CzIPN, 2 mol%) as photocatalyst in the presence of DIPEA in CH
3CN (
Table 1, entry 1). Encouraged by this result, the influence of the base was firstly investigated. The screening of other bases such as DABCO, DBU, Cs
2CO
3, KOH, and K
3PO
4 disclosed that DBU could give product
4aa in relatively higher yield (
Table 1, entry 3). Then, a series of photocatalysts were examined to improve the reaction efficiency and the result showed that 4CzIPN was still the best photocatalyst (
Table 1, entries 7–14). Next, the solvent effect was tested to improve the reaction efficiency. Among various solvents such as CH
2Cl
2, THF, 1,4-dioxane, EtOAc, DCE, acetone, DMF, DME, MeOH, DMSO, EtOH and H
2O examined, CH
2Cl
2 was found to be the best reaction medium to afford product
4aa in 63% yield (
Table 1, entry 15, and details in Supporting information). No transformation was observed without visible-light irradiation (
Table 1, entry 16). Further investigation of reaction condition was performed under the irradiation of other blue LED lamps with different wavelength ranges (
Table 1, entries 17–20). The results demonstrated 10 W blue LED lamps (450–455 nm) was the optimal light source to give the product
4aa in 70% yield (
Table 1, entry 20). The optimization of the loading of photocatalyst found that the highest yield of
4aa (77%) was obtained when 1 mol% 4CzIPN was employed in this reaction (
Table 1, entry 22). The desired product
4aa was not detected in the absence of photocatalyst (
Table 1, entry 23). Finally, when the model reaction was conducted in air, the desired product could also be obtained in 61% yield (
Table 1, entry 24).
